编程道义逻辑

时间:2010-08-30 12:22:47

标签: prolog reasoning

我需要为道义逻辑编写规则,是否有任何编程语言可以做到这一点?我看到了prolog,我现在正在学习,但是如何在PROLOG中表达道义逻辑?请帮忙

1 个答案:

答案 0 :(得分:1)

2018年的这篇论文声称将宗法逻辑桥接到SAT,有关如何实现的一些想法,请参见2015年的论文:

Deontic Logic推理基础架构-2018 克里斯托夫·本斯默勒,泽维尔·父母和莱恩特·范德托
http://page.mi.fu-berlin.de/cbenzmueller/papers/C69.pdf

用于标准Kripke结构的基于SMT的BMC方法 上午。 Zbrzezny-2015年 http://www.ifaamas.org/Proceedings/aamas2015/aamas/p2021.pdf

许多Prolog系统都有SAT求解器。你可以尝试一下 这些线。这是一些带有SAT解算器的Prolog系统:

SWI-Prolog CLP(B):
http://www.swi-prolog.org/pldoc/man?section=clpb

Jekejeke Prolog CLP(B):
http://www.jekejeke.ch/idatab/doclet/prod/en/docs/15_min/10_docu/02_reference/07_theory/03_finite/06_tree.html

相关问题